Greetings from Carolina Beach, North Carolina, USA: A Timeless Snapshot of the 1940s Carolina Coast Step back in time with this image of a carefree summer day at Carolina Beach, North Carolina, in the year 1941. The sun-kissed sand and gentle waves of the Atlantic Ocean serve as the idyllic backdrop for this charming scene, where two young girls, dressed in summer frocks and with arms linked, run playfully towards the camera. The vibrant lettering on the wooden sign behind them, "Carolinas Playground, Carolina Beach, North Carolina, USA," adds a sense of nostalgia and excitement to the image. The 1940s were a time of optimism and leisure, as America embraced the joys of simple pleasures and the freedom of vacation. Carolina Beach, with its beautiful coastline and laid-back atmosphere, was the perfect destination for families and friends seeking a respite from the daily grind.
